AI Summary

  • Voids and makes unenforceable any deed, contract, bylaw, or restriction that effectively prohibits or unreasonably restricts installation of electric vehicle charging stations in a unit, designated parking space, or owner's limited common area.

  • Requires condominium administrative bodies to process and approve charging station applications within 60 days or the application is deemed approved, unless delay results from reasonable requests for additional information.

  • For charging stations in limited common areas, owners must use licensed contractors, comply with architectural standards, obtain liability insurance naming the condominium as additional insured, and bear all costs for installation, electricity, maintenance, and repairs.

  • Permits administrative bodies to deny installations based on bona fide safety requirements consistent with building codes, deny requests when no reasonable area is available, or create new parking spaces to facilitate installation.

  • Establishes a civil penalty of up to $1,000 against condominium administrative bodies that willfully violate the section; requires owners installing stations to indemnify the condominium against liability claims.
